Seasons Hospice wants to be able to enhance the quality of life for our patients by offering translators for that patient/family who needs the services of a translator to facilitate a visit by our clinical staff. When a patient is signed on to our service and they speak no English, an interpreter accompanies one of our clinical staff to make sure that the patient and family understand about hospice from the clinical as well as legal perspective. The non-English speakers can make sure that our staff understands their wishes, that their questions are understood by our staff as well. The volunteer translator will be required to go to the patient's home wherever that might be: in their own home, in a nursing facility, assisted living residence, in-patient unit, hospital, etc.

Seasons Hospice & Palliative Care serves the DFW area, with an office in Fort Worth and Dallas, and ensures quality of life to hospice patients.
Hospice is a vision of caring that gives patients with terminal illness choices about how they spend the last days of their lives. SEASONS HOSPICE also recognizes that individuals and families are the true experts in their own care.
SEASONS HOSPICE supports the volunteers and staff so that they can put our patients and families first, find creative solutions which will add quality of life.
SEASONS HOSPICE strives for excellence beyond accepted standards and tries to increase the communities awareness of hospice as a part of the continuum of care.
